I  have a large, thick plate of aluminum and to it I have bolted about a dozen Alpha Delta switches (all with a gas discharge tube) . Every antenna line is connected and every radio as well, it allows me to easily connect any source to any receiver, transceiver, etc.

I will have my cables grounded at the top of the tower(s) as well as they enter my shack.  Nevertheless I want to make certain that this switch board is effectively connected to my SPG.

I want to make this connection with a wide copper strap. In the past I used brass plates between the copper strap and the aluminum plate and used stainless steel bolts to hold it tight.  I also used one of the greases (don't remember which one) to keep moisture/air out of the areas of contact.

Is this right?
Is there a better way?
